I think that is one of the ones without the locking arrangement on the swivel head. They made 2 different styles of locking pins and one style without the lock. We talked about that before on here.

Hi Lewill2,

  does that mean that it can swivel up and down and not being able to lock it in position ???

  Frank

Lewill2


Lewill2

#4
That style was never machined with the notches for a lock pin and it was never machined for the locking pin and spring.

2 different style lock pins. The wrench on the Left has one of the segments broken out at the lock pin.
